Homeward Bound is a blue (easy) run at Homewood Ski Area measuring 2.7 km, dropping 302 m from 2220 m down to 1918 m. It averages a 10.8% gradient, steepening to around 25.1% at its most sustained pitch.
Snowboard-friendly: no significant flat or uphill sections detected along the descent.
Watch for 5 uphill sections: 25 m of climb about 0 m in; 25 m of climb about 1.2 km in; 25 m of climb about 1.6 km in.
